Part-Time Shipping and Retail Associate
About the role
This position generally works 18-25 hours per week.
Responsibilities
- Follows instructions of supervisor and assist other Team Members in performing limited store functions
- Understands and models the Purple Promise to make every FedEx experience outstanding
- Assembles parcels and prepares goods for shipping by wrapping items in insulation, inserting items into shipping containers, weighing packages, and affixing labels to parcels
- Demonstrates consultative behaviors in a retail environment to understand each customer’s individualized need
- Maintains a safe, clean and orderly retail Store
- Ensures all customer problems are resolved quickly and to the satisfaction of the customer
- Ensures confidentiality of customer data and careful handling of documents, media, and packages
- Assists with processing financial transactions using a Point of Sale terminal (POS), including handling cash and making change
- Cleans and stocks all retail Store printing and shipping equipment and supplies to provide optimal performance and availability
- Takes preemptive action to prevent errors and waste
- Follows FedEx Office standard operating procedures as well as adhering to legal, HR, safety, customer service and security policies and procedures
Qualifications
- High school diploma or equivalent education
- Excellent verbal and written communication skills
